contents The regency of Sumba Tengah in the province of East Nusa Tenggara relies on rainfall to support its dry land agriculture hence should be supported with land suitability evaluation and cropping pattern design for a more sustainable crop production. This study aims to evaluate land suitability for food crops in Sumba Tengah and formulate the appropriate precipitation-based cropping patterns. This work was carried out from March to June 2015. Stages of research were: 1) characterizing land attributes (climate and soil) by soil analysis and desk study, 2) assessing land suitability level by comparing land attributes and crops requirements, and 3) composing feasible cropping patterns by using water balance method. Soils of Sumba Tengah varied from sandy to clayey with low to neutral pH and low to very high content of organic carbon and nitrogen. Phosphate and potassium availability was very low. Sumba Tengah was exposed to only four wet months a year with annual precipitation of less than 2000 mm. This region was highly and moderately suitable for growing paddy, maize, tubers, and legumes. It was not suitable for wheat. Some of the northern part was arable merely for one cropping season in a year, mostly from December to April, with the alternative of growing paddy or other crops. The remaining was likely to cultivate for two cropping seasons. Legumes were recommended to include in the rotation for soil conservation. Shortage of irrigation led to the unlikeliness of three cropping seasons in a year.
